As for the lower level umpires, some of their expenses are covered, but when theyre without contracts for events, flights will be paid out of their pocket. per informarci del problema. There are 33 gold badge umpires on the circuit right now, and as you can see from the list below, theyre the ones we see on all the show courts at the main tournaments. Wenn The Australian Open paid $375 (AUD) in 2011, and they are the only Grand Slam to offer overtime for umpires officiating over 10 hours per day. Longtime ESPN tennis stalwarts with new contracts (year joined ESPN): Darren Cahill (2007), Chrissie Evert (2011), Mary Joe Fernandez (2000), Brad Gilbert (2004), John McEnroe (2009), Patrick McEnroe (1995), Chris McKendry (1996) and Pam Shriver (1990).
